Vilar Maior is a place and a former municipality ( Freguesia ) in the Portuguese district of Sabugal . The community had 121 inhabitants (as of June 30, 2011).

On September 29, 2013, the municipalities of Vilar Maior, Badamalos and Aldeia da Ribeira were merged to form the new municipality of União das Freguesias de Aldeia da Ribeira, Vilar Maior e Badamalos . Vilar Maior is the seat of this newly formed community.
